Civ 7 has launched to poor reviews from longtime series fans, some of whom call the game incomplete. But Firaxis has promised ...
Civilization 7 is out, and while the game has launched to a ‘mixed’ user review rating on Steam, the boss of parent company ...
Sid Meier’s Civilization VII is currently discounted when you pre-order for PC and Steam, here's how to secure the deal.
Civilization 7's full launch sees another influx of Steam players hit the strategy game, which has had a rather rocky start to life.
Sid Maier’s Civilization 7 just launched in advance access, and let’s just say – it’s not going over well. Players are pretty ...